cnc编程开头有什么不一样
-
在CNC编程中,开头部分通常包括程序的头部信息和程序起始代码。它们是CNC编程的基础,对于程序的正确性和可读性起着至关重要的作用。在编写CNC程序时,开头部分的不同会影响整个程序的运行和效果。
首先,头部信息是CNC程序中的重要组成部分之一。它包含了程序的名称、作者、日期、单位制、坐标系、刀具补偿等信息。这些信息对于后续操作和维护非常重要,能够方便操作员和维护人员进行程序的管理和修改。
其次,程序起始代码是CNC程序中的第一段实际运行的代码。它通常包括初始位置设定、刀具半径补偿设置、工件坐标系设定等内容。这些代码的作用是为后续的加工操作提供正确的基础,确保程序能够正确运行,并保证加工的准确性和精度。
另外,开头部分的不一样还体现在不同的机床和编程语言中。不同的机床可能有不同的坐标系和刀具补偿方式,因此开头部分的代码会有所不同。而不同的编程语言也会有不同的语法和命令,因此开头部分的编写方式也会有所不同。
总的来说,CNC编程的开头部分是CNC程序中的重要组成部分,它包含了程序的头部信息和程序起始代码。这些信息和代码对于程序的正确性和可读性起着至关重要的作用,因此在编写CNC程序时,我们需要根据具体需求和机床要求编写相应的开头部分,以确保程序能够正确运行并满足加工要求。
1年前 -
CNC编程的开头部分与其他编程任务相比具有一些不同之处。下面是CNC编程开头的几个不同之处:
-
机床选择:CNC编程的第一步是选择适合特定任务的机床。不同的机床具有不同的能力和功能,因此需要根据工件的要求来选择合适的机床。这包括机床的类型(如铣床、车床、钻床等)、工作台的尺寸、主轴的转速范围等。
-
工件定位:在CNC编程中,准确的工件定位是至关重要的。工件定位包括确定工件在机床上的准确位置和方向。这需要考虑工件的尺寸、形状和特殊要求,以确保在加工过程中能够精确地定位工件。
-
刀具选择:CNC编程中的下一步是选择适合特定任务的刀具。刀具的选择取决于工件的材料、形状和加工要求。不同的刀具有不同的切削特性,如切削速度、进给速度和切削力。正确选择刀具可以提高加工效率和加工质量。
-
坐标系设置:CNC编程中的一个重要步骤是设置坐标系。坐标系是用来描述工件在机床上的位置和方向的系统。常见的坐标系包括绝对坐标系和相对坐标系。在设置坐标系时,需要确定参考点和坐标轴的方向,并将其与机床的坐标系对应起来。
-
初始运动:在CNC编程中,需要指定机床的初始运动。初始运动包括将刀具移动到工件的起始位置,并设置切削参数。这可以通过编写适当的指令来实现,如G代码和M代码。初始运动的设置需要考虑工件的安全性和切削效果。
综上所述,CNC编程的开头部分与其他编程任务相比具有一些不同之处。它涉及机床选择、工件定位、刀具选择、坐标系设置和初始运动等步骤,以确保正确和高效地完成加工任务。
1年前 -
-
CNC(Computer Numerical Control)编程是通过计算机控制数控机床进行加工的过程。在开始进行CNC编程时,有一些不同的方面需要考虑和处理。下面是一些与传统编程方法不同的CNC编程的开头。
1.机床和工件设置:在CNC编程中,需要先考虑和设置机床和工件的参数。这包括机床的类型(如铣床、车床、钻床等)、工件的尺寸、材料和夹具等。这些参数将直接影响到后续的编程和加工操作。
2.坐标系选择:CNC编程中需要选择适合的坐标系进行编程。常见的坐标系有绝对坐标系和相对坐标系。在绝对坐标系中,机床坐标原点固定,而在相对坐标系中,坐标原点可以根据需要进行设置。坐标系的选择将决定后续编程中的坐标计算方式。
3.刀具选择和长度补偿:根据加工要求,需要选择合适的刀具进行加工。同时,还需要考虑到刀具的长度和补偿。刀具长度补偿是指根据刀具的实际长度来进行修正,以确保加工的精度和准确性。
4.刀具路径规划:CNC编程需要根据工件的形状和加工要求来规划刀具的路径。这包括选择合适的切削策略(如开粗、开精、插补等)和路径类型(如直线、圆弧等)。刀具路径规划需要考虑到加工效率、表面质量和刀具寿命等因素。
5.加工参数设置:在CNC编程中,还需要设置一些加工参数,如进给速度、切削速度和切削深度等。这些参数将直接影响到加工过程中的切削力、热量和加工效率等。
6.编程语言选择:CNC编程可以使用多种编程语言,如G代码、M代码、ISO代码等。不同的编程语言有不同的语法和指令集,需要根据机床和加工要求选择合适的编程语言进行编写。
以上是CNC编程开头时与传统编程方法不同的一些方面。在进行CNC编程时,需要综合考虑机床、工件、刀具、路径和参数等多个因素,以确保编程的准确性和加工的质量。
1年前